Compared to two weeks ago: Slaughter cows and bulls sold 5.00 to 7.00 higher. Replacement cows sold steady. Feeder cattle sold sharply higher.

500–600 lb heifers averaged $382.56/cwt on 34 head, up $24.15 from the prior sale (only 16 head in that comparison). That ranks 14 of 26 comparable sales and sits +1.46 against this barn's trailing median of $381.10.

One grade step is worth $29.11/cwt here — about $87 a head. Across this sale the premium is widest at 300–400 lb. USDA reports each grade on its own line and never publishes the spread.
